Amin Bbosa: Kyabazinga to Open Masaza Cup in Budiope

Table of Content

Kyabazinga of Busoga Dr William Wilberforce Kadumbula Gabula Nadiope iv gracing masaza cup opening recently

By Musa Kikuuno

The Kyabazinga of Busoga, Dr. William Wilberforce Kadhumbula Gabula Nadiope IV, will officially open the 2025 Busoga Masaza Cup this Saturday, July 12, at Irundu Primary School in Budiope, Buyende District.

The confirmation came from Busoga Kingdom Sports Minister Owekitibwa Amin Bbosa Nkono, who praised the organizing committee and assured fans that all preparations are in place. “Security is tight, fans are ready, and we’re set to welcome His Majesty,” said Bbosa while speaking to Busoga Times and Baba TV on Friday.The opening match will see hosts Budiope face Bukono at 3 PM — a fiery rematch after Bukono knocked Budiope out in last year’s quarterfinals.

Budiope is hungry for revenge, but Bukono remains confident.All roads lead to Irundu tomorrow as football and royalty unite for the 8th edition of the Masaza Cup.
